I'm not, nor have I ever been married to the mother of my 7month old son. She's bitter about the fact that my girlfriend and I are getting married soon and that I chose my g/f over her. To get back at me, she's going back to court to get our court order/agreement amended. What she purposely did was cut her hours at work so that she can get more child support. In addition to that, she plans to move to another city (not another state). My 2 questions are, 1: Can she quit her job or cut hours to force me to pay more support (will the judge increase the current payments) 2: Can she legally move to another city w/o my consent? I'm the non custodial parent. Thanks in advance for your input/responses.
